搭建视频网盘是一个涉及技术选型、用户体验、法律合规等多维度的系统性工程,无论是个人用户存储家庭影像,还是企业团队共享培训资料,亦或是内容创作者管理作品,都需要从需求出发,兼顾稳定性、安全性与易用性,本文将从核心需求拆解、技术架构搭建、功能优化设计、法律合规保障及长期运营维护五个维度,详细解析视频网盘的构建逻辑,帮助不同需求的用户找到合适的实现路径。

搭建视频网盘

核心需求拆解:明确网盘定位与用户场景

在搭建视频网盘前,首要任务是明确目标用户与核心使用场景,个人用户可能更关注大容量存储、多设备同步与隐私保护;企业用户则需要团队协作、权限分级与内容管理功能;内容创作者则可能涉及视频素材加密、版权保护与分发需求,家庭用户可能需要支持4K视频的长期存储,而企业团队可能更看重在线预览与批量下载效率,需求明确后,才能针对性选择技术方案与功能模块,避免资源浪费或功能冗余。

技术架构搭建:从存储到播放的全链路设计

视频网盘的核心挑战在于“大文件存储”与“流畅播放”,技术架构需围绕这两个痛点展开,同时兼顾扩展性与成本控制。

存储层:选择合适的存储方案

视频文件体积大(一部4K电影可达50GB以上),需采用分布式存储架构,结合对象存储(如阿里云OSS、腾讯云COS)与本地存储:

  • 对象存储:适合存储海量非结构化数据,支持高并发访问、自动扩容,按实际使用量计费,成本可控;
  • 本地存储:对于需高频访问的热点视频(如企业培训常用素材),可部署本地NAS(网络附加存储)或分布式文件系统(如MinIO、Ceph),降低访问延迟。
    需设计存储策略:冷数据(如长期未访问的家庭录像)存于低频存储介质,热数据(如近期创作素材)存于高性能存储,平衡成本与性能。

处理层:视频转码与适配

不同设备(手机、平板、电脑)与网络环境(Wi-Fi、5G、4G)对视频格式、分辨率要求不同,需搭建视频处理服务:

搭建视频网盘

  • 转码与切片:使用FFmpeg等工具将上传视频转码为H.264/H.265编码(兼顾清晰度与压缩率),并切片为HLS(HTTP Live Streaming)或DASH格式,实现自适应码率播放;
  • 水印与加密:对于版权内容,可添加动态水印(如创作者ID、时间戳),或采用AES-256加密存储,仅授权用户可解密播放。

传输层:优化上传下载效率

大文件传输易因网络波动中断,需支持分片上传与断点续传:

  • 分片上传:将大文件拆分为固定大小(如5MB/片)的分片,并行上传,提升速度;
  • CDN加速分发网络(如阿里云CDN、Cloudflare),将视频缓存至边缘节点,用户访问时就近获取数据,降低延迟,尤其对偏远地区用户效果显著。

应用层:用户界面与交互设计

前端需适配多端(Web、iOS、Android、TV端),采用响应式设计,核心功能包括:

  • 文件管理:文件夹分类、标签标注、搜索(支持标题、标签、内容关键词检索);
  • 播放功能:支持倍速播放、画中画、进度记忆,提供清晰度切换(480P/720P/1080P/4K);
  • 分享与协作:生成分享链接(可设置密码、有效期),企业版支持角色权限(管理员/编辑/只读),团队共享文件夹实时同步。

功能优化设计:提升用户体验的关键细节

除了基础功能,细节优化直接影响用户留存率,需重点关注以下方向:

智能化辅助

  • AI分类:通过图像识别(如人脸识别自动分类家庭录像)、语音识别(自动生成视频字幕)等功能,减少用户手动整理成本;
  • 智能推荐:基于用户观看历史,推荐相关视频(如用户常看“教程类”视频,优先展示同类内容)。

离线与多端协同

  • 离线下载:支持移动端缓存视频,无网络环境下也能播放;
  • 实时同步:PC端上传后,移动端自动同步,避免多设备文件不一致问题。

数据分析(企业版)

提供播放量、用户停留时长、热门视频等数据报表,帮助运营者了解内容效果,优化资源分配。

搭建视频网盘

法律合规保障:规避版权与安全风险 易涉及版权与隐私问题,合规是网盘长期运营的底线:

版权审核机制

  • 用户协议:明确用户需拥有上传内容的版权,或已获得授权,禁止上传侵权、违法内容; 审核**:结合AI识别(如图像识别敏感画面、文本识别违规字幕)与人工审核,定期排查违规内容,下架侵权视频并记录用户行为。

数据安全与隐私保护

  • 加密传输:采用HTTPS协议,确保上传、下载过程中的数据不被窃取;
  • 隐私政策:明确数据收集范围(如用户登录信息、观看记录),未经用户同意不得向第三方泄露,遵守《网络安全法》《个人信息保护法》等法规。

备份与容灾

定期备份数据(异地备份+云备份),防止服务器故障、自然灾害导致数据丢失,确保服务可用性达到99.9%以上。

长期运营维护:持续迭代与成本控制

网盘搭建后,需通过持续运营维持竞争力:

性能监控与优化

使用监控工具(如Prometheus、Grafana)实时跟踪服务器负载、带宽使用率、播放卡顿率,及时扩容或优化代码,应对用户量增长。

用户反馈迭代

建立用户反馈渠道(如在线客服、意见箱),定期收集功能需求与问题,优先解决高频问题(如播放卡顿、上传失败),每1-2个月发布版本更新。

成本控制

  • 存储成本:通过冷热数据分层、定期清理过期文件(如用户30天未登录的临时文件)降低存储费用;
  • 带宽成本:采用按量计费的CDN,避免带宽闲置,对超大文件(如100GB以上)设置下载限速,减少突发流量冲击。

搭建视频网盘不仅是技术实现,更是对用户需求的深度理解与合规经营的长期坚持,无论是个人还是企业,都需从“存储-处理-传输-体验”全链路设计,兼顾技术先进性与实用性,同时以法律合规为底线,通过持续优化提升用户信任度,只有将技术与需求、合规结合,才能构建一个真正有价值、可持续发展的视频网盘平台。

引用说明

  1. 视频转码技术参考:FFmpeg官方文档(https://ffmpeg.org/)
  2. 对象存储方案:阿里云OSS产品文档(https://www.aliyun.com/product/oss)、腾讯云COS产品文档(https://cloud.tencent.com/product/cos)
  3. CDN加速原理:中国信息通信研究院《CDN技术发展白皮书》
  4. 网络安全法规:《中华人民共和国网络安全法》(2017年施行)、《中华人民共和国个人信息保护法》(2021年施行)
  5. 分布式存储系统:MinIO官方架构文档(https://min.io/docs/)、Ceph官方文档(https://docs.ceph.com/)

相关内容

回顶部